School Funding Budget Issues

Letter from the Superintendent

December 4, 2009 

Dear Royal Oak Schools Parents, Staff & Community:

The School District of the City of Royal suffered three major reductions in state revenue in the month of October 2009:

  • October 8 -   $165 per pupil from legislative budget approval ($891,000)
  • October 19 - $261 per pupil by Governor's 20j veto ($1,400,000)
  • October 22 - $127 per student - Governor's Executive Order ($685,800)

In total, our school system is expected to absorb nearly $3 million dollars of reduction in anticipated state revenue ($553 per pupil) within our current operations even though we are now five months into our fiscal year.
